Kazakh President receives world’s leading neurosurgeons in Astana

President Kassym-Jomart Tokayev met with leading representatives of global neurosurgery at the Akorda Palace during their visit to Astana for the 10th World Congress. He highlighted that hosting such an important forum confirms international recognition of Kazakhstan’s achievements in neurosurgery. The President expressed confidence that the event will strengthen cooperation and the exchange of advanced practices. Emphasizing the importance of integrating digital and robotic solutions, including artificial intelligence, to advance neuroscience in the country, Tokayev praised the scientific contributions of the participants. He also expressed Kazakhstan’s interest in expanding international collaboration, aimed at sharing experience and facilitating the transfer of medical technologies. In response, foreign experts affirmed their readiness to support Kazakhstan in the continued modernization of its neurosurgical sector.
